According to a referral from the Stock Exchange of Thailand (SET) and SEC’s further investigation, it was found that during December 2017 – February 2018, Chantip, by virtue of her position as director of UVAN, knew inside information about the significant increase of company’s profits in the fourth quarter of 2017. According to referral from the Stock Exchange of Thailand (SET) and SEC’s further investigation, it was found that during January - February 2017 Apichart Sukjirawat, Assistant Managing Director in charge of Accounting and Finance of ICHI, knew the inside information related to ICHI's financial statement year 2016, which would show a decline in the net earnings resulting from net operating loss in the fourth quarter of 2016. The SEC has imposed civil sanction on Mr. Jajjai Dhammarungruang, Vice President and Executive Director of Modernform Group Public Company Limited (MODERN), for using inside information to sell the company's shares through the trading account of Ms. Benjamas Dhammarungruang. Both offenders paid civil penalties and compensation for the received benefits, at the total amount of 2.58 million baht. The SEC has imposed civil sanction on two offenders, namely Mr. Sarath Teganjanavanich and Ms. Malita Limlomwongse, for using inside information to buy shares of Thai Optical Group Public Company Limited (TOG). The offenders paid civil penalties and compensation for the received benefit, at the total amount of 4.83 million baht. Earlier, the Civil Sanction Committee resolved to impose civil sanctions on Mr. Thanawat, who was IFEC director and executive at the time of the offence. He was ordered to pay a civil fine and return any gains from the wrongdoings.* Mr. Thanawat came in to acknowledge the civil sanctions, but did not consent to comply with the punishment terms within the specified time.
